10 QUESTIONS WITH JOHN KRAUSE


Each issue we ask an industry professional the Tomorrow’s Tile & Stone 10 Questions. This month, we chatted to John Krause, Managing Director at Diespeker & Co...

WHAT WAS YOUR FIRST JOB? I came to Diespeker straight from


school taking a job as a draftsman, so I’ve been part of the company for 39 years now.


HOW DID YOU GET INTO THE INDUSTRY?


My father had bought Diespeker so I was moving into the family business. Even when I was very young I envisaged myself running a ‘good’ business. It matters a lot to me to offer something rather special.

DAVE ROWLEY, TRAINING MANAGER


FROM BAL, ASKED: HOW MUCH DO YOU VALUE TRAINING WITHIN YOUR


ORGANISATION? We put a great deal of value on training at Diespeker & Co – we recently had training at our factory from Consentino on working with their latest product, Dekton. And we have had training for our resin-based terrazzo work from Kempa, our Italian supplier.
